Dune Analytics

For blockchain researchers who require custom data queries, Dune Analytics is the undisputed standard. Its thriving ecosystem of analysts has created tens of thousands of open-source dashboards covering virtually all blockchain project imaginable.
Key Features:
- Code-driven bespoke query creation
- Extensive public dashboard repository
- Real-time blockchain data from multiple chains
- Open-source tier for individual analysts

Arkham Intelligence

Arkham is the leading tool for entity-centric blockchain analysis. By combining blockchain address data with open-source identity data, Arkham enables analysts to unmask addresses linked to known entities.
Main Features:
- Identity-focused on-chain analysis
- Address de-anonymization across multiple chains
- Visual transaction graph tools
- AI-powered identity labeling system
